Welcome to Seminole County!
As a resident or owner of residential property located in unincorporated Seminole County, you have access to a variety of services and improvements that are generally available through municipalities. The most common services available to residential properties located within the unincorporated boundaries of Seminole County are street lighting and solid waste collection and disposal. Funding for these services is provided through non-ad valorem assessments which are billed annually along with property taxes.

There are two basic types of non-ad valorem assessments associated with the Seminole County MSBU Program – term assessments and variable rate assessments.

Term assessments are related to construction projects that required extended financing over a period of years in order to enhance the affordability to property owners for project repayment. On an annual basis, a fixed installment payment (assessment) is posted to the property tax bill for collection. The balance may be paid in full at any time. Property owners can obtain information regarding the pay off amount by contacting the MSBU Program office.

Variable rate or open-ended assessments are assessments assigned to MSBUs that do not have a set closure date and for which annual assessments are calculated annually based on projected cost to provide continuation of the service or improvements in the forthcoming year. For example, the assessments for solid waste collection and disposal, street lighting or aquatic weed control districts are variable rate assessments.

Each year in August, the proposed assessment roll (list of assessments by property) is reviewed and approved by the Board of County Commissioners at a Public Hearing. Once the assessment roll is approved, the assessments are certified for collection through the property tax statements distributed by the Tax Collector.
